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
6662138154 33977 91821395
3426358 846 06802880548
3426358 846 06802880548
3034574 65 81
All about undefined
Interested in learning more?
3426358 846 06802880548
3034574 65 81
See more
6106039247 1027300
2507040791 5676 37395 17
See more
239301080 5307466999
13057787792 5107 22921818 08324059192
See more